The designation puc is derived from the classical p prefix denoting plasmid and the abbreviation for the university of california, where early work on the plasmid series had been conducted. The artificial plasmid puc18 has been genetically engineered to include 1 a gene for antibiotic resistance to ampicillin amp r, and 2 a gene and its promoter for the enzyme betagalactosidase lacz.
